Output f98670f71a815f174beb3e6769c6c20c5d4b36ec298fdc21d4fd4dfa7b178892:82

value
27487566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ba64dbdf5e5156f68b9b62d6ffbc22a597536bd5 OP_EQUAL
address
3JgaS2DkAJy9pUzPc3jUm9VUqEvvwR8yJ5
transaction
f98670f71a815f174beb3e6769c6c20c5d4b36ec298fdc21d4fd4dfa7b178892
spent
true